技术文摘
DB2数据服务器使用常见问题FAQ
DB2数据服务器使用常见问题FAQ
在数据库管理领域,DB2数据服务器是一款备受青睐的产品。然而,在使用过程中,用户常常会遇到一些问题。本文将对DB2数据服务器使用中的常见问题进行解答。
问题一:如何连接到DB2数据服务器?
要连接到DB2数据服务器,首先需要确保安装了相应的客户端软件。在配置好客户端环境后,可使用命令行工具或图形化界面工具。例如,通过命令行,使用“db2 connect to <数据库名称> user <用户名> using <密码>”命令来建立连接。图形化工具则提供了更直观的操作界面,方便用户输入连接信息。
问题二:DB2数据库性能缓慢怎么办?
性能缓慢可能由多种原因导致。一方面,检查数据库的索引是否合理。不合理的索引会导致查询效率低下,可通过分析查询语句和数据访问模式来优化索引。另一方面,查看服务器资源使用情况,如CPU、内存等。若资源紧张,可考虑升级硬件或优化数据库配置参数。
问题三:如何备份和恢复DB2数据库?
DB2提供了多种备份和恢复方法。对于全量备份,可使用“db2 backup database <数据库名称>”命令。恢复时,使用“db2 restore database <数据库名称>”命令。还支持增量备份和日志备份,用户可根据实际需求选择合适的备份策略,以确保数据的安全性和可恢复性。
问题四:遇到错误代码如何解决?
当遇到错误代码时,首先要准确记录错误代码和相关信息。然后,通过DB2官方文档查找该错误代码的含义和解决方法。也可以在相关技术论坛或社区寻求帮助,分享具体的错误场景和操作步骤,以便其他技术人员能够更好地协助解决问题。
问题五:如何管理DB2数据库用户和权限?
可以使用“CREATE USER”语句创建新用户,通过“GRANT”和“REVOKE”语句来授予和撤销用户的权限。例如,“GRANT SELECT ON TABLE <表名> TO <用户名>”可授予用户对指定表的查询权限。
掌握这些DB2数据服务器使用的常见问题解答,能帮助用户更高效地使用和管理数据库。